Focusing On Tire Health for Maximum Grip



The link between your SUV and the frozen sidewalk relaxes completely on four spots of rubber. In Harrisburg, where high hillsides can develop into slides throughout a light freezing rain, tread deepness is your very first line of defense. All-season tires frequently lose their flexibility when the thermometer stays below freezing for prolonged durations. Switching to specialized wintertime tires gives a significant benefit since the rubber substance remains soft and flexible in the cold. Keeping an eye on your tire stress is likewise important throughout a Pennsylvania cold wave. For every 10 degrees the temperature level drops, your tires can shed regarding one pound of stress, which directly influences exactly how well your SUV deals with on an unsafe curve.



Keeping Visibility Through Snow and Slush



Exposure continues to be one of the largest difficulties for drivers in the funding area. Between the salt spray from freeway plows and the hefty slush that accumulates during a tornado, your windshield can end up being covered in seconds. Typical wiper blades typically fight with the weight of hefty ice or the freezing mist usual in the valley. Installing durable winter months blades that feature a safety rubber boot aids prevent ice accumulation on the arm itself. This makes certain the blade maintains regular contact with the glass. Furthermore, filling your storage tank with a winter-grade washing machine fluid that contains de-icer is a little action that makes a massive difference when you are stuck behind a truck on I-83.



Making Sure Reliable Power and Engine Performance



Winter is infamously hard on car batteries, and a battery that worked completely in the damp Harrisburg summer season could fall short when the first deep freeze arrives. The chemical reactions required to start an engine slow down considerably in low temperatures, while the engine oil ends up being thicker and more challenging to relocate. Having a professional examination your battery's find here cranking amps prior to the heart of winter is the best means to stay clear of being stranded in your driveway. While you are examining under the hood, validate that your engine coolant is blended at the proper proportion to avoid freezing inside the radiator. Protecting the Exterior and Undercarriage



The chemicals and salt used to deal with the roadways around the Pennsylvania State Capitol work at thawing ice, yet they are unbelievably hostile toward your SUV's metal and paint. In time, salt buildup can lead to corrosion on the underbody and brake lines. Using a high-quality wax prior to the initial snow supplies a sacrificial layer of security for your clear coat. It is also an excellent routine to spray down the wheel wells and undercarriage at a regional automobile laundry after a storm has actually passed and the roads have dried out. This basic maintenance task expands the life of your automobile and keeps it looking its ideal in spite of the severe environment.



Preparing an Emergency Kit for Regional Travel



Also the most well-maintained SUV can deal with unforeseen hold-ups during a major ice event. Web traffic mishaps or road closures can leave motorists waiting on extended durations, making an onboard emergency set a necessity for any kind of local resident. Your kit should consist of things tailored to the chilly, such as heavy blankets, extra gloves, and a durable ice scrape with a brush. Consisting of a tiny bag of sand or non-clumping kitty trash can supply the grit required to obtain relocating if you find yourself spinning in an icy auto parking spot near the Farm Show Complex. Heating and Defrosting Systems



The convenience of a cozy cabin is a deluxe in July yet a safety and security need in January. Your SUV's defrosting system is accountable for keeping the side windows and mirrors clear so you can browse lane adjustments securely. If you discover that your heating unit takes an unusually long time to heat up or that the air originating from the vents feels warm, it might suggest a problem with the thermostat or a reduced coolant level. Ensuring these systems remain in peak condition allows you to concentrate on the roadway instead of having a hard time to translucent a fogged-up window.
